The weather is set to be mainly dry after a thunderstorm warning was issued yesterday
It's set to be largely dry and warm in Greater Manchester this weekend after a thunderstorm warning was issued by the Met Office.
In our region, temperatures will climb to around 25C this afternoon. Sunny and cloudy spells are expected for much of the day.Some rain showers may fall at around 7pm, with a few downpours predicted through the night into the early hours. But brighter conditions are then forecast again for Saturday.
